Yoshihiro Maru Hits 150th Career Home Run! Reflecting on His Glory with the Giants and Special Commemorative Merchandise
So, it’s finally happened. Yoshihiro Maru, career home run number 150. The moment he stepped into a Giants uniform and sent that ball to the right-field foul pole at the Tokyo Dome, the crowd absolutely erupted. As someone who’s followed his career since his Hiroshima days, this milestone really hits home. He’s never been a pure power hitter. He chokes up on the bat, and with that unique, top-hand swing, he laces line drives all over the field. Seeing him pile up numbers like this just shows the depth and beauty of baseball.
The Giants’ “Glue Guy”: The True Value of No. 150
What makes this 150th home run more valuable than the number itself is his “clutch factor.” Since coming to the Giants, Maru has continued to be the team’s “glue guy.” Sometimes he hits in the heart of the order, other times he’s leading off and getting on base. No matter where he’s slotted, he just goes about his business with a true professional’s composure. Last season, when I saw that “BC Mascot” (the Maru Cheese charm) hanging from his jersey, I couldn’t help but laugh. But that charm, combined with his easy-going personality and on-field intensity, shows just how essential he’s become to the Giants.
